The fantasy football Week 7 schedule is here and the best sleepers for this week include Jerick McKinnon, Kelvin Benjamin, Jonathan Stewart, Andre Holmes, Malcom Floyd, Bernard Pierce, Isaiah Crowell, Storm Johnson, Eddie Royal, Odell Beckham, Bishop Sankey and Davante Adams, as those names have the chance to put up big numbers based on injuries and matchups heading into the weekend.

McKinnon and Matt Asiata have a matchup with the Bills and they have played well with Adrian Peterson out of the lineup for the Vikings. The Panthers are hoping Kelvin Benjamin can play against the Packers and if he is in the lineup, he could be a very strong start option with Cam Newton. Jonathan Stewart is expected to come back and he will take over the starting RB position and he could open things up for the Panthers offense.

The Giants play against the Cowboys and while Dallas is 5-1, the Giants still can put up numbers and Odell Beckham and Rueben Randle are options after Victor Cruz was injured. Cruz is done for the season and that makes Beckham one of the best sleepers going forward, as he will be in a starting role now. Andre Holmes is coming in after having a breakout game for the Raiders in a loss last week and he had two touchdowns and now could be a favorite target for quarterback Derek Carr.

Bernard Pierce has the chance for a big game against the Falcons, as Atlanta has been getting gashed by running backs this season so far. Jonathan Stewart is expected to play for the Panthers this week after being injured and he could be a huge sleeper with DeAngelo Williams also dealing with an injury. Stewart is expected to start for the Panthers in Week 7 and he is a smart option, while Isaiah Crowell could be another option with the Browns.

Stewart has just 88 yards this season on the ground in three games, but he should be refreshed and ready to go after being out for a few weeks for the Panthers. Cleveland plays Jacksonville this weekend and Crowell has been getting into the endzone consistently even with Ben Tate back. Malcom Floyd has been playing well and with how much the Chargers throw, he is a solid option after making five catches for 103 yards last week against the Raiders. Floyd has 17 catches this season for 362 yards and three touchdowns.

Benjamin is coming into the weekend after dealing with a concussion and he is likely to play despite the head injury. Benjamin has been one of the most consistent targets for the Panthers and he has four touchdowns already this season, including two in the past three games. Benjamin has 15 catches in that span and he has shown he can be a reliable target in the redzone.

McKinnon is a solid start option and he comes in after rushing 11 times for 40 yards and adding six catches for 42 yards against the Lions. McKinnon had his best game of the season a few weeks ago against the Falcons and now he has another chance to perform well against the Bills. Asiata will get carries too, but McKinnon comes in as the starter and should stay there for a while.
